We’ll make sure that whatever your level, you’ll have a great trip! A LITTLE BIT ABOUT TARIFAWindsurfers discovered Tarifa’s windy secret over 20 years ago. It lies on the southernmost tip of Europe, only a stone’s throw away from the African continent. The narrow body of water between the two landmasses is known as the Straits of Gibraltar; and this is the machine that keeps the wind blowing.Tarifa is located at the narrowest point, some 11km or so wide, and no matter which way the wind is blowing, it will be squeezed through the gap in what is known as a ‘Venturi’ effect. This culminates in the claim that Tarifa is the ‘Wind Capital of Europe’ with around 300 days of wind per year. The Conditions: Tarifa isn’t just about wind, due to it’s location at the tip of Europe it is known to be the point at which two bodies of water meet: the Mediterranean, and the Atlantic. This means there are lots of ‘spots’ within an hours drive with a huge range of conditions on offer, from gentle breezes and flat water through to 50 mph winds and huge surf, making it a great spot for all of us that love the water. Weather: As we are situated at the furthest point south you can possibly be in mainland Europe, and 11k or so from Africa, sunblock is essential! Summer temps average at 25- 35 degrees, Winter temps average at 15 – 25 degrees. On the water: In summer a shorty or no wetsuit is fine, and during the winter a full wetsuit or steamer is required. (We have a range of wetsuits for your use.) Wind: Tarifa has around 300 days of wind a year, see below as a guide: A cultural melting pot: Due to it’s close proximity to Africa, Tarifa has always been an eclectic place where two very different cultures meet. The town has a Moorish feel, with an old fortress and tiny whitewashed winding streets, within the old town’s walls. For those people that enjoy the cultural pleasures in life there is much here to tempt the senses. Sample the freshest tuna from the fish market, immerse yourself in café culture, or just stretch out on ‘playa chica’ a small sheltered beach reserved for sunbathing only! KITESURFINGKitesurfing is one of the fastest growing watersports of the moment - a combination of wakeboarding, parascending and windsurfing - a true sport for the 21st century. Anyone who is fairly confident in the water and has a 'go for it' attitude really can master the basics in as little as 1 week.FIRST TIMERSCOURSE OUTLINEFirst off, you'll be mastering basic kite control, using trainer foil kites scudding through the sand whilst learning about the wind-window and launching and landing drills.Then you will move up to the larger inflatable kites. You'll be shown how to set them up and manage them properly, with safety information covered too. Then one of the best bits, body-dragging with the kite in the water! Finally you'll be arming yourself with a board and venturing out for your first runs on the water. "We'll always look for the spot with the best conditions, to make your learning curve as quick as possible..." Tuition is totally hands on for the early part of the course, and the aim is for you to steadily grow in confidence until you are more and more self sufficient as the week draws on. The instruction will then assume a more coaching role with lots of advice, video feedback and the all important safety cover. LEARN TO WINDSURFIn 1 or 2 weeks we’ll take you through the basics, like standing on the board, pulling up the sail, wind theory, cruising in light winds and basic turns.We start with nice stable boards to get your balance on which are coupled with light rigs to kick start your learning curve. Turning around and coming back to where you started is the goal for day one. The aim though is to fast-track you through this, and move on to wearing a harness to take the pressure off your arms and then to the exhilarating part - planing in the footstraps and going FASTER! BOOST YOUR WINDSURFING SKILLSOne of the best things about windsurfing is that you never stop learning – but often you can get stuck in a rut – and that is where we come in.With the best kit available and an instructor to take you to the best spot for the conditions on the day, you will really be able to boost your skills to the next level. We run all our courses along RYA guidelines, and they have just released a new Fast Forward scheme that really will revolutionise your windsurfing. Rather than focusing on levels and jumping through hoops, the emphasis is on giving you a simple formula to think about when you are on the water - simplifying moves down to five basic elements, no matter what you are doing on the board. The new course also enables you to analyse your mistakes and learn from them, making it easier to progress to the next stage. MIX IT UP!Just sit back and relax ... MTB TARIFATarifa and its beaches are set in front of the stunning peaks of the Los Alcornacales national park. There are hundreds of trails running through the area, from easy pedals through to more challenging rides with some reaching up to 1500 ft above sea level.If a member of your family is seriously into watersports and you aren’t, or if you’re a hard core hillsman who fancies mountain biking in the morning and trying something different, like kitesurfing or windsurfing, in the afternoon, then this is the ideal place for you. We have mapped and test ridden a series of tracks for the beginner through to the expert, ranging from 1-6 hours and will guide you throughout the trail.
